Vehicles we typically see

Many college students typically donate their first cars, which often include reliable models like Honda Civics, Toyota Corollas, Nissan Sentras, Ford Foci, and Volkswagen Jettas. These vehicles generally range from 10 to 20 years old, with mileage between 100,000 and 200,000. While they may need repairs costing between $1,000 and $3,000, the donation can still provide benefits without the hassle of selling a vehicle in poor condition.

FAQ

How do I donate my car if I’m moving out of state?
If you're moving out of state, you can still donate your car. We assist with the title transfer process remotely and can arrange for picking up your vehicle from your new location.
What if I can’t sign the title myself?
No problem! If you're a recent grad and your parents are the legal owners, they can sign the title by mail. We’ll guide you through the necessary steps to ensure everything is done correctly.
Can I get a tax deduction for my donation?
Yes! While you may not be itemizing, your parents can potentially claim a tax deduction for the donation. We provide all necessary documentation (IRS Form 1098-C) for tax purposes.
How quickly can my car be picked up?
We understand that timing is crucial. Our team is equipped to arrange for quick pickups, often within a few days, so you can focus on your move.
What happens to my car after I donate it?
Once donated, your car will be repaired and sold. Proceeds from the sale benefit local charities in Wilkes-Barre, so you’re making a positive impact in your community!
Are there any costs involved in donating my car?
There are no costs to you when donating your car. We cover the expense of pickup and any other associated fees, making this process completely free for you.
What if my car doesn’t run?
That’s okay! We accept cars in any condition, even those that don’t run. Our goal is to simplify the donation process for you and help you with your transition.
